The FDA mentions limits proposed by industry Reps, which include ten ppm, biological activity ranges for instance 0.1% of the conventional therapeutic dose, and organoleptic ranges such as no obvious residue. The posted Lilly requirements are which the gear is visually thoroughly clean, any active agent is existing in a very subsequently developed solution at most amounts of 10 ppm, and any Energetic agent is present inside a subsequently developed products at utmost amounts of 0.one% of the minimal everyday dose from the active agent in the highest every day dose of the subsequent product.

Swab sampling internet site shall not be recurring and re-swabbing shall not be finished from the exact same place of equipment wherever the swab sample is already collected ahead of.

Swabbing is done in painting motion throughout the floor, very first making use of the swab inside of a vertical movement, after which you can applying the swab (soon after rotating it ninety°) in a very horizontal movement While using the reverse floor on the swab.
